Pros & Cons

Eldorado
Advantages
Eldorado offers a unique cultural heritage shaped by diverse European immigrant communities [5, 12].
The city is surrounded by the natural beauty of the Misiones jungle and the Paraná River, providing ample outdoor recreational opportunities [5, 9].
The subtropical climate offers warm conditions year-round, with mild winters [4, 7].
Key industries like wood processing and agriculture, including yerba mate cultivation, provide economic activity [5, 12].
The cost of living in Argentina is generally lower than the global average, making Eldorado a potentially affordable place to live [19, 21, 24].

Elyria
Advantages
The cost of living in Elyria is significantly l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to reside.
Elyria boasts a high livability score and ample local amenities, including restaurants, grocery stores, and parks.
The city's crime rate is lower than the national average, contributing to a generally safe environment.
Housing in Elyria is notably affordable, with a median property value significantly below the national average.
Elyria offers a strong sense of community and a friendly, small-town atmosphere.
Drawbacks
The employment sector in Elyria has received a low grade, indicating challenges in the job market.
Public transportation options are limited, leading to high car dependency for most residents.
Some residents perceive a lack of nightlife and entertainment options for adults, describing the city as 'boring' for that demographic.
The city faces issues with road quality, including bad streets and potholes.
Shopping opportunities have been noted as dissipating from what was once a booming city.
